When I got the W427 bar the proper grilles were going to cost me about $300 from memory, which I couldn't afford or justify at the time so I just went to Autobarn and got some of their black mesh for $19.95. I think it was a metre long by 250mm wide, certainly enough to do my 5 grille sections with some left over. I doubt anyone would even know unless they saw mine and a genuine W427 side by side and in fact I'm 99% sure it's looks identical to what HSV used on VX Clubbies. It also comes in other colours eg silver and red from memory, possibly others.
